Transaction 57e3fcbb944e99bb59ee010095c5f9d77acde6c9bb5f9fb13435731e489d57e5

2 Input
2 Outputs
  • 57e3fcbb944e99bb59ee010095c5f9d77acde6c9bb5f9fb13435731e489d57e5:0
  • value  3543791292
    address  3KgtbGgaX2ngstNpvyv7LwpHSweVeqGbpM
  • 57e3fcbb944e99bb59ee010095c5f9d77acde6c9bb5f9fb13435731e489d57e5:1
  • value  7812259
    address  14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K